Roe Valley Community Playgroup Playgroup Roe Valley Community Playgroup was established in 1996. We provide Quality Childcare in a secure setting for up to 60 children aged between 3 and 4 years with morning or afternoon care during their pre-school years. WELB Pre-school Expansion Programme – Free spaces All morning places are free to those children who are in their immediate pre-school year and are registered with the WELB pre-school expansion programme. Children must be three years old before 30th June to be eligible for a free place in the following September. Fee paying spaces We have a fee paying session in the afternoon available on a first come first served basis. Competition for these places is high and it is advisable to book at least a season in advance. National Curriculum We currently follow the national curriculum and provide learning through play during various activities. Children are encouraged to participate in various activities on offer such as sand and water play, art and crafts, construction and imaginative play. Staff At present we have four fully qualified members of staff who hold all the recognised childcare qualifications (NVQ III Childcare) and attend ongoing training courses throughout the year. The staff team are supported by Volunteers and Students throughout the year. Funding As we are a community based playgroup we organise many fundraising events to aid playgroup resources throughout the year and to help pay for the children’s outings and some equipment; we are indebted to our parents for their support. WELB fund the morning sessions and the fees support the afternoon session. Healthy Living The policy within Roe Valley Community Playgroup is to provide the children with a healthy snack each day that is accompanied with a selection of fruit. The children will choose from milk or water to drink with their snack. All children are encouraged to participate in daily teeth cleaning routine. These snacks are included in both sessions at no extra cost. Outdoor physical activity is an important part of the routine. See for yourself!
